Mozilla致力于Firefox中的Google Translate集成
- 类别: 火狐浏览器
您是否知道Firefox网络浏览器具有与Google Chrome类似的翻译功能?大多数Firefox用户可能不知道,因为默认情况下未启用它,并且未在选项或用户界面中突出显示。
Mozilla在2014年2月透露 致力于集成机器翻译功能 在Firefox网络浏览器中 开始包括 2014年5月每晚版本的浏览器中的功能。
Mozilla在Firefox中的翻译支持的第一个版本使用Bing Translate来翻译网站内容。它的工作方式类似于Chrome的Google Translate实施。
当用户访问Firefox中未安装的语言的网站时,将显示通知栏。该栏突出显示检测到的页面语言,并提供翻译选项。单击“翻译”将以默认浏览器语言翻译页面,选择“不立即”将隐藏提示。
还提供了“从不翻译”检测到的语言或网站的选项。
Mozilla添加了对 Firefox中的Yandex翻译41 它于2015年中发布。它去 全黑 此后不久;该功能并未推向稳定的渠道,并且在随后的三年中仅发布了一些修复程序。
上周当Mozilla停止活动时 开始了 在Firefox网络浏览器内置的翻译引擎中添加对Google Translate的支持。
尽管该功能尚未完全发挥作用,但这表明Mozilla尚未完全忘记翻译功能。在about:config上启用Firefox中的翻译功能的用户会注意到,谷歌是选定的翻译引擎。
在Firefox地址栏中加载about:config?filter = browser.translation,以显示首选项。
- browser.translation.detectLanguage -将其设置为True,以使Firefox检测页面的语言。
- 浏览器翻译引擎 -确定Firefox使用哪种翻译服务。支持的是Google,Bing和Yandex。
- browser.translation.ui.show -定义打开外语网站时Firefox是否显示翻译用户界面。设置为True以显示UI,设置为False以隐藏它。
Firefox当前无法使用Google翻译;当您在用户界面中点击“转换”按钮时,浏览器会抛出一条错误消息。尽管Firefox似乎尝试翻译页面,但Bing和Yandex似乎都无法正常工作。最终也会引发“翻译此页面时出错”错误。
Google翻译需要API访问密钥,通常只有在公司或用户为密钥付费时才能使用。目前还不清楚Mozilla是否计划与Google达成交易,或者是否要求用户使用自己的API密钥来实现该功能。后者肯定是非常有限的。
扩展名
附加组件开发人员创建了许多扩展,这些扩展以一种或多种方式集成了Firefox中的翻译功能。 Google翻译栏 是最早复制谷歌浏览器翻译栏的公司之一;它于2010年与其他扩展程序一起推出,例如 Facebook翻译 要么 翻译这个 。
但是,这些扩展名不再起作用,因为Mozilla在Firefox 57中切换到了其他扩展名系统。如果在Mozilla AMO上搜索翻译扩展名,则会得到大量与Firefox 57及更高版本兼容的扩展名:
- 快速翻译 使用Google翻译翻译所选文本。
- S3翻译器 使用Google翻译翻译所选内容或页面。
现在轮到你 :您是否需要浏览器中的翻译功能?